首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>指定RMarkdown上的CSL样式

指定RMarkdown上的CSL样式
EN

Stack Overflow用户
提问于 2014-12-10 02:41:59
回答 3查看 4.4K关注 0票数 8

我正在尝试为我的RMarkdown文档指定CSL样式,如下所示

代码语言:javascript
复制
---
documentclass: article
fontsize: 12pt
linkcolor: blue
output: pdf_document
bibliography: bibliography.bib
csl: biomed-central.csl
---

但它给了我一个错误

代码语言:javascript
复制
pandoc-citeproc.exe: biomed-central.csl: openBinaryFile: does not exist (No such file or directory)
pandoc.exe: Error running filter pandoc-citeproc
Error: pandoc document conversion failed with error 83

Windows 7 64 bitR Version 3.1.2RStudio 0.98.1091上,如何指定CSL样式。

EN

回答 3

Stack Overflow用户

发布于 2014-12-15 15:29:33

在您的工作目录中包含.csl文件。您可以从here下载.csl文件

票数 4
EN

Stack Overflow用户

发布于 2016-10-04 23:10:19

您还可以指定绝对路径。这是可行的,至少在我的Linux系统上。

票数 1
EN

Stack Overflow用户

发布于 2019-02-10 21:11:55

除了@Keniajin的答案之外,我们还可以指定绝对路径或相对路径,如果我们将它放在引号中,例如

代码语言:javascript
复制
csl: "<folder>/biomed-central.csl"  # path to child folder
csl: "../biomed-central.csl"  # path to parent folder
csl: "X:/<folder>/biomed-central.csl"  # absolute path (in windows)

此外,我们还可以对*.bib*.tex等其他链接文件执行相同的操作。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/27386420

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档